Here are some general tips to start you off! I know lots of people who have played beta, and I myself have been known to play at least three alts at any given time. With hundreds of hours over numerous characters, let me tell you, from my humble experience that the fastest way to level up and make cash is to take as many quests as possible and attempt to do them in an efficient manner. So, here are some ideas for you. Just follow some basic principles! These are as follows. 1) Take as many quests as possible and at the same time, try not to do quests one at a time. When entering a new area, find all the quests from NPC's first, before you start killing things. Who knows? Everything you are killing out there could be for a quest, as could all of the items they potentially are dropping. You can read quest basics or use mods to tell you where to go do quests all together in the quickest manner. For example, if you have three quests for Felfire Hill, and four for Warsong Lumber camp, and they all turn in in Forest Song, you might choose to run down to Felfire first, finish them up there, then head to the Lumber camp. Once you are finished there, run back to Forest Song and turn everything in! It is so much better than get Quest A, do Quest A, run back, drop off, get Quest B, do Quest B... You get the idea. 2) A simple and easy group of 2 or 3 people such as tank + healer + DPS is sometimes far better than solo'ing. This is especially efficient when a quest calls for "kill X amount of something". Use groups when they suit you. Leave a group when they slow you down. Gathering quests are usually no so good in a group because you end up competing over quest items or other loot. But when quests require you to do a dungeon run or kill lots of mobs, you might just want those few extra bodies to help you along. 3) Play a Multi-Zone game. When you hit level 10 or so, it is time to run to the nearest "other" starting area and do the quests there. You will do them fast, and get exp for all the kills, as long as they are colored green to you. Doing a load of quests 3 to 5 levels beneath you really racks up experience fast, so do not hesitate to take those green quests and fight green mobs! Experience is experience, and quests are quests. Do not discriminate. 4) Green quests are your friends! AGAIN, I just stressed this above. These are quests that are 2 to 3 levels beneath you. When I get a bunch of yellow colored quests, sometimes I will just 'level grind' 2 to 3 levels, then power through the quests solo. It basically comes to this: If you are getting killed more than once doing a single quest, you are wasting time. It is better to grind a level and do it later. But, you do not even need to level grind necessarily. Just get a wide variety of quests so that you will always have green ones to do. By the time you get through one set of green quests, chances are that the ones that were yellow before are now green! Time management is key. 5) Now, do not be afraid to dump quests. I have been known to keep quests because they sound so cool, or because I want an item from them. Sometimes, a quest is just so darn tempting. You just do not want to let go of that quest that has been in your books for several days. It requires you to run around the world - see this person, see that person... and will probably take you 3 hours. Or that quest you forgot to do way back in 6) Level Grinding still works, even if it is the most boring thing on earth! This is essentially killing monsters that are only GREEN to you. Why Green? Because you kill them faster than any other mob that gives you EXP and with very little down time to speak of. You can basically steamroll through dozens of closely huddled green enemies in minutes! Spend an hour or two doing this and you will see what a difference in EXP it makes! Small EXP gains over a long period time really add up. This is quite boring, but in between quests it is a nice little bonus boost in your EXP total. 7) Decide if you are going for power or wealth (or both) before you decide on your profession. Professions mean downtime. Downtime means less power leveling time. Ask yourself the question, "Will mastering this profession take too much extra time and hinder my primary goal?". Take professions that do not slow you down, or do not take any at all if your primary focus is quick and efficient leveling. 8) Minimize your downtime. If money is not a concern to you, use potions, bandages, or whatever else to keep you from having to eat and drink a lot. You can also minimized downtime by killing mobs of a slightly lower level than you (green). 9) USE MODS! There are so many mods out there that will help you level faster by helping you organize maps, quests, and mob information. Use them when you can because they will make you so much more efficient than you ever could imagine. Now we are going to get into the talents you will want to take. 42 Add 5 points to either Axe, Sword, or Mace 43 – 1 / 1 Sweeping Strikes 44 – 1 / 2 Weapon Mastery 45 – 2 / 2 Weapon Mastery 46 – 1 / 1 Mortal Strike 47 – 1 / 2 Second Wind 48 – 2 / 2 Second Wind 49 – 1 / 2 Blood Frenzy 50 – 1 / 5 Improved Mortal Strike 51 – 2 / 5 Improved Mortal Strike 52 – 3 / 5 Improved Mortal Strike 53 – 4 / 5 Improved Mortal Strike 54 – 5 / 5 Improved Mortal Strike 55 – 1 / 1 Endless Rage 56 – 1 / 5 Unbridled Rage 57 – 2 / 5 Unbridled Rage 58 – 3 / 5 Unbridled Rage 59 – 4 / 5 Unbridled Rage 60 – 5 / 5 Unbridled Rage 61 – 1 / 1 Piercing Howl 62 – 1 / 5 Improved 63 – 2 / 5 Improved 64 – 3 / 5 Improved Batter Shout 65 – 4 / 5 Improved 66 – 1 / 5 Dual-Wield Specialization 67 – 2 / 5 Dual-Wield Specialization 68 – 3 / 5 Dual-Wield Specialization 69 – 4 / 5 Dual Wield Specialization 70 – 5 / 5 Dual Wield Specialization QUICK, CHEAP ARMOR TO KEEP YOU GOING When you are power leveling, you are not really going to want to bother with trying to twink. So here are some quick tips for what armor to buy. Just get armor that has the stats for your class. =================================================================== | of the Monkey | Agility, Stamina | | of the Falcon | Agility, Intellect | | of the Tiger | Agility, Strength | | of the Wolf | Agility, Spirit | | of the Eagle | Intellect, Stamina | | of the Gorilla | Intellect, Strength | | of the Bear | Strength, Stamina | | of the Whale | Spirit, Stamina | | of the Boar | Spirit, Strength | | of the Owl | Spirit, Intellect | | of Blocking | Block Rating, Strength | | of the Ancestor | Strength, Crit Rating, Stamina | | of the Bandit | Agility, Stamina, Attack Power | | of the | of the Beast | Strength, Agility, Stamina | | of the Champion | Strength, Stamina, Defense | | of the Crusade | Spell Damage, Intellect, Defense | | of the Elder | Stamina, Intellect, Mana Regen | | of the Grove | Strength, Agility, Stamina | | of the Hunt | Attack Power, Agility, Intellect | | of the Hierophant | Stamina, Spirit, Healing | | of the Invoker | Intellect, Spell Damage, Spell Crit | | of the Knight | Stamina, Spell Damage, Defense | | of the Mind | Spell Damage, Spell Crit, Intellect | | of the Nightmare | Shadow Damage, Stamina, Intellect | | of the Physician | Stamina, Intellect, Healing | | of the Prophet | Intellect, Spirit, Healing | | of the Shadow | Attack Power, Agility, Stamina | | of the Soldier | Strength, Stamina, Crit Rating | | of the Sorcerer | Stamina, Intellect, Spell Damage | | of the Sun | Spell Damage, Stamina, Intellect | | of the Vision | Spell Damage, Intellect, Stamina | | of the Wild | Attack Power, Stamina, Agility | Most importantly, go out there and have fun.
